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ll create a detailed plan to extract water, dry the area, and prevent further dam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use advanced equipment to extract water from the affected area, including p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ers. This step is critical to preventing further damage and reducing drying time.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will set up drying equipment to reduce moisture levels and prevent mold growth.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ize the space to remove any lingering bacteria, mold, or mildew. This step ensures your property is safe for occupancy.

Step 5: Restoration and Repairs

Our team will work with you to restore your property to its pre-damage condition. This may include repairs, replacements, or refinishing damaged materials.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Extraction

Water damage can sneak up on you, but there are warning signs to look out for.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ty smells in your condo. This could show hidden water damage or mold growth. Our team can quickly identify the source and provide a solution.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

If your flooring is warped or discolored, it may be a sign of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a plan to restore your floors.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of a leaky roof or burst pipe. Our team can quickly identify the source and provide a solution.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. Our team can assess the damage and provide a plan to restore your walls.

Symptoms of Mold Growth

If you notice black mold or mildew growing in your condo, it’s essential to act fast. Our team can quickly ident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Condo Water Extraction Cost in Mableton, GA

The cost of Condo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the required equipment and labor.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and duration of drying process
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ning required

Common Questions About Condo Water Extraction

Q: What’s the difference between water extraction and drying?

A: Water extraction involves removing standing water from the affected area, while drying involves reducing moisture levels to prevent mold growth. Our team uses advanced equipment to ensure both steps are completed efficiently and effectively.
